Does anyone have pictures of a CSVT with component speakers installed in the front doors. What I really want to see is where someone had a custom plate made from fiberglass and installed the component speakers.
 
Are you asking about installation in the Factory holes or in Kick panels or cutting the door panel up and making a new fiberglass enclosure?

I made a custom plate for 6.5" component speakers in the doors and use metal strapping to bridge the woofer for a tweeter mount. By no means glamorous but it does the job and looks factory.

Mine is in the stock speaker location. The crossover is located next to the speaker under the door panel. No cutting or modification of the panel is required. You will be able to put factory speakers back in. If you do not cut the factory speaker connector off.
